How they compare
Tonga currently reports 2.1 against 1.1 in Peru, a difference of 1.
That makes Tonga's figure about 1.9 times Peru's.
Across all 16 years both countries report, Tonga has been ahead every year.
Peru ranks 8th and Tonga ranks 7th of 17 countries.
Tonga has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Peru | Tonga |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010s | 4.22 | 7.82 | 3.6 | Tonga |
| 2020s | 2.2 | 4.37 | 2.17 | Tonga |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
